Blake Lively, Ryan Reynolds' losing 'image war' against Justin Baldoni: expert

Ryan Reynolds and Blake Lively may be losing the "image war" in legal drama with Justin Baldoni as "It Ends With Us" court battle weighs on public perception....                        ...                        ...                            ...What was initially believed to be You are not allowed to view links. Register or Login addressing issues about her "It Ends With Us" director and co-star, Justin Baldoni, in a complaint filed with the California Civil Rights Department, troubles have since spiraled into multiple lawsuits between the actors and finger-pointing on either side.......Now with more than one year until an official trial, experts believe the court of public opinion has heavily influenced the cases with mismanaged public relations woven in between......."There are no real winners here, but right now, Blake and Ryan are losing the image war," You are not allowed to view links. Register or Login......"The reputational risk of legal action only pays off when you have overwhelming public support, an airtight case and full control of the narrative. None of that seems to be true here."......LaManna added, "You are not allowed to view links. Register or Login brought serious sexual harassment allegations, and that can't be ignored. She and Ryan may have decided that speaking out was worth the reputational fallout, no matter the cost. But this is a he-said-she-said that is getting messier by the day, and it's getting harder for Blake and Ryan to come out looking clean. ......"Fighting a case is one thing, winning over the public is another. If they can't do that, their only option may be to step back and let time make people forget."......You are not allowed to view links. Register or Login......Lively filed a sexual harassment suit in December against Justin Baldoni, his Wayfarer studio and former PR reps. Register or Login......"Rather than escalating this battle in such a public way, Lively and Reynolds might have benefited from a quieter, more calculated approach," Mandell said. "The entertainment industry is built on relationships, and while standing up against alleged wrongdoing is important, allowing the dispute to play out through social media, public jabs, and lawsuits can do more harm than good."......Mandell added, "A more strategic approach would have been to address these issues earlier—before tensions and theories got to this point. By waiting until things had already started unfolding, they may have lost control of the narrative and made the situation more complicated than necessary. Had they acted sooner with a measured and private strategy, they could have allowed the legal process to handle the core issues while minimizing collateral damage to their reputations.......You are not allowed to view links.
